The 36-year-old woman who was stabbed multiple times in the chest with a screwdriver at around 1:30 p.m. on Monday is expected to survive, police told Bay City News. Officers arrested Wilber Echeverria, 27, of San Francisco at the scene, on the 2900 block of 26th Street, near York.
From the Bay City News report, in the SF Appeal:
“[Officers] recovered the weapon from the victim’s car, which was parked nearby with the windows open.
“Echeverria was arrested on suspicion of attempted murder, battery and domestic violence.”
